Kitchen & Cookware Stores
The Kitchen and Cookware Stores industry has experienced moderate growth over the five years to 2019 in line with expanding markets for both new kitchen equipment and replacement goods. During the five-year period, growth in housing market activity has supported an influx of industry demand from new equipment buyers. Existing home sales and housing starts have both risen during the period, leading consumers on the move to furnish their new kitchens with quality appliances and cookware and bolstering the industry's new equipment market. same year. Although economic conditions have improved over the five years to 2019, supporting demand for kitchen and cookware products, industry retailers have continued to experience mounting external competition from a range of operators that include department stores, mass merchandisers and online-only retailers. Over the five years to 2024, sustained growth in the housing market and subsequent rises in home sales are anticipated to drive demand for industry products. However, an increasing level of both internal and external competition, as well as an expected decline in the Consumer Confidence Index, are projected to hinder the industry from a more robust expansion.
This industry includes operators that primarily sell kitchen and cookware such as pots and pans, bakeware, cutlery and utensils. Merchandise is generally purchased from domestic manufacturers and wholesalers and then sold to the public.
